| library get.handler; |
| |
| import 'dart:io'; |
| |
| import 'package:analyzer/src/generated/engine.dart'; |
| |
| import 'package:analysis_server/src/analysis_server.dart'; |
| |
| /** |
| * Instances of the class [GetHandler] handle GET requests |
| */ |
| class GetHandler { |
| /** |
| * The path used to request the status of the analysis server as a whole. |
| */ |
| static const String STATUS_PATH = '/status'; |
| |
| /** |
| * The analysis server whose status is to be reported on, or `null` if the |
| * server has not yet been created. |
| */ |
| AnalysisServer server; |
| |
| /** |
| * Initialize a newly created handler for GET requests. |
| */ |
| GetHandler(); |
| |
| /** |
| * Handle a GET request received by the HTTP server. |
| */ |
| void handleGetRequest(HttpRequest request) { |
| String path = request.uri.path; |
| if (path == STATUS_PATH) { |
| _returnServerStatus(request); |
| } else { |
| _returnUnknownRequest(request); |
| } |
| } |
| |
| /** |
| * Return a response indicating the status of the analysis server. |
| */ |
| void _returnServerStatus(HttpRequest request) { |
| HttpResponse response = request.response; |
| response.statusCode = HttpStatus.OK; |
| response.headers.add(HttpHeaders.CONTENT_TYPE, "text/html"); |
| response.write('<html>'); |
| response.write('<head>'); |
| response.write('<title>Dart Analysis Server - Status</title>'); |
| response.write('</head>'); |
| response.write('<body>'); |
| response.write('<h1>Analysis Server</h1>'); |
| if (server == null) { |
| response.write('<p>Not running</p>'); |
| } else { |
| response.write('<p>Running</p>'); |
| response.write('<h1>Analysis Contexts</h1>'); |
| response.write('<h2>Summary</h2>'); |
| response.write('<table>'); |
| _writeRow( |
| response, |
| ['Context', 'ERROR', 'FLUSHED', 'IN_PROCESS', 'INVALID', 'VALID'], |
| true); |
| server.contextMap.forEach((String key, AnalysisContext context) { |
| AnalysisContentStatistics statistics = |
| (context as AnalysisContextImpl).statistics; |
| int errorCount = 0; |
| int flushedCount = 0; |
| int inProcessCount = 0; |
| int invalidCount = 0; |
| int validCount = 0; |
| statistics.cacheRows.forEach((AnalysisContentStatistics_CacheRow row) { |
| errorCount += row.errorCount; |
| flushedCount += row.flushedCount; |
| inProcessCount += row.inProcessCount; |
| invalidCount += row.invalidCount; |
| validCount += row.validCount; |
| }); |
| _writeRow(response, [ |
| '<a href="#context_$key">$key</a>', |
| errorCount, |
| flushedCount, |
| inProcessCount, |
| invalidCount, |
| validCount]); |
| }); |
| response.write('</table>'); |
| server.contextMap.forEach((String key, AnalysisContext context) { |
| response.write('<h2><a name="context_$key">Analysis Context: $key}</a></h2>'); |
| AnalysisContentStatistics statistics = (context as AnalysisContextImpl).statistics; |
| response.write('<table>'); |
| _writeRow( |
| response, |
| ['Item', 'ERROR', 'FLUSHED', 'IN_PROCESS', 'INVALID', 'VALID'], |
| true); |
| statistics.cacheRows.forEach((AnalysisContentStatistics_CacheRow row) { |
| _writeRow( |
| response, |
| [row.name, |
| row.errorCount, |
| row.flushedCount, |
| row.inProcessCount, |
| row.invalidCount, |
| row.validCount]); |
| }); |
| response.write('</table>'); |
| List<AnalysisException> exceptions = statistics.exceptions; |
| if (!exceptions.isEmpty) { |
| response.write('<h2>Exceptions</h2>'); |
| exceptions.forEach((AnalysisException exception) { |
| response.write('<p>${exception.message}</p>'); |
| }); |
| } |
| }); |
| } |
| response.write('</body>'); |
| response.write('</html>'); |
| response.close(); |
| } |
| |
| /** |
| * Return an error in response to an unrecognized request received by the HTTP |
| * server. |
| */ |
| void _returnUnknownRequest(HttpRequest request) { |
| HttpResponse response = request.response; |
| response.statusCode = HttpStatus.NOT_FOUND; |
| response.headers.add(HttpHeaders.CONTENT_TYPE, "text/plain"); |
| response.write('Not found'); |
| response.close(); |
| } |
| |
| /** |
| * Write a single row within a table to the given [response] object. The row |
| * will have one cell for each of the [columns], and will be a header row if |
| * [header] is `true`. |
| */ |
| void _writeRow(HttpResponse response, List<Object> columns, [bool header = false]) { |
| if (header) { |
| response.write('<th>'); |
| } else { |
| response.write('<tr>'); |
| } |
| columns.forEach((Object value) { |
| response.write('<td>'); |
| response.write(value); |
| response.write('</td>'); |
| }); |
| if (header) { |
| response.write('</th>'); |
| } else { |
| response.write('</tr>'); |
| } |
| } |
| } |
